Book Description

Can a loyal companion heal two damaged hearts?

After her life is shattered by divorce, Abby Clifford retreats to her family’s mountain cabin in Colorado with her six-year-old daughter, Charlotte, to heal. Then she comes face-to-face with the man she never thought she’d see again. Noah Ross broke Abby’s teenage heart. Now she wants nothing to do with the handsome veterinarian. But when Noah’s in danger of getting evicted from his condo because of his two Hungarian vizsla dogs, Abby reluctantly allows him and his K-9s to spend time on their property. Charlotte immediately bonds with the sweet dogs. Will Abby ever forgive the past and embrace a fresh start?
